The Silver Invicta

-

BY TOM HARLAND POLARIS £17.99 ★★★★★

I envy writers who can put pen to paper (or fingers to keyboard) and effortless­ly write beautiful prose – more so when it’s a work of non-fiction. Harland appears to have this particular gift, turning his anecdotes of fishing on Scotland’s rivers and its lochs into evocative stories that almost read like poetry.

In fact, I read The Silver Invicta as I would a love story, finding myself deeply invested in Harland’s relationsh­ip with Scotland’s waterways and the fish swimming within. Each of his angler’s tales is full of sentiment, bursting with vivid details that bring the natural world to life and complete with both the joys and trials and tribulatio­ns of his adventures.

It has been some years since I last fished (in Canada’s lakes and rivers) with my father, but Harland’s eloquent storytelli­ng has me longing to put on some waders and cast my own line. Well worth a read, angler or not.
